Which of the following statement are true for genetic drift ?
I. It upsets the Hardy-Weinberg equilbrium
II. It operates only in small population
III. It is responsible for preserving certain genes
IV. It is responsible for eliminating certain genes

A

I,II,III

B

II,III,IV

C

I,II,IV

D

I,II,III,IV

To determine which statements about genetic drift are true, let's analyze each statement step by step: ### Step 1: Analyze Statement I **Statement I: It upsets the Hardy-Weinberg equilibrium.** - **Explanation**: The Hardy-Weinberg equilibrium states that allele frequencies in a population remain constant from generation to generation in the absence of evolutionary influences. Genetic drift, which is a random change in allele frequencies, can disrupt this equilibrium. Therefore, this statement is **true**. ### Step 2: Analyze Statement II **Statement II: It operates only in small populations.** - **Explanation**: Genetic drift has a more pronounced effect in small populations because random events can significantly alter allele frequencies. In larger populations, these random changes tend to average out. Thus, this statement is also **true**. ### Step 3: Analyze Statement III **Statement III: It is responsible for preserving certain genes.** - **Explanation**: Genetic drift does not preserve genes; rather, it can lead to the loss of alleles from a population. It is more about random changes that may eliminate certain alleles rather than preserving them. Therefore, this statement is **false**. ### Step 4: Analyze Statement IV **Statement IV: It is responsible for eliminating certain genes.** - **Explanation**: Genetic drift can lead to the elimination of alleles from a population, especially through mechanisms like the bottleneck effect and founder effect. Hence, this statement is **true**. ### Summary of Findings Based on the analysis: - Statement I: True - Statement II: True - Statement III: False - Statement IV: True Thus, the true statements for genetic drift are I, II, and IV. ### Final Answer The true statements about genetic drift are: **I, II, and IV.** ---
